'Fever' represents one of the highest points on Klinik's career. Very dark and introspective, 'Fever' has a sinister climax with typical obscure whispers. 'Public Pressure' keeps the same dark and growling whispers and complex EBM drums, and 'Desire' is more calm on a more minimal base, also in the presence of these kind of vocals. But the massive tune is the all-time classic 'Moving Hands', a combination of full dancefloor EBM influenced by an electro beats base with more aggressive vocals.
